Video: Look At Calvin Oftana's Swipe At Paul Lee, Foul Or No Foul?


TNT wingman Calving Oftana (#8). Photo credit: PBA Images.

TNT Tropang Giga lost to the Magnolia Hotshots, 94-92, last Wednesday because of a controversial foul call on Calvin Oftana on Paul Lee. Lee calmly sank the resulting free throws with a little over four seconds remaining in the game for the final tally.

The win preserved Magnolia's unbeaten record this conference, 3-0, while TNT was unable to win its first game, 0-1.

TNT head coach Chot Reyes was fined 50,000 pesos by the PBA for his emotional outburst immediately after the game. Team manager Jojo Lastimosa was also slapped with a 20,000-peso fine "for crossing the court and confronting game officials and the technical table."

The league released a statement on Thursday saying:

“The Office of the Commissioner will fine Coach Chot 50k for crossing the court to confront the game officials and the technical table, as well as incessantly shouting invectives/shouting profanities at game officials while exiting the Araneta Coliseum’s south gate.”

There were no suspensions given, however.

Meanwhile, Oftana shrugged off the issue, saying that it's just part of the game.

“No comment. Ganun talaga ang basketball,” Oftana said in an interview. “May mga ganung bagay na nangyayari talaga.”

“We need to move on and look forward to the next game,” he added.
